Web波前(英文名:wavefront),有时也被称为波面。. 其实个人会觉得叫波面更贴切,因为它描述的就是一个和光线传输方向垂直的一个曲面,也就是 光束中各等相位点所形成的面, … Web31 mrt. 2024 · The PSF is the FFT of the Wavefront Map squared. If we plot the PSF using the following settings: We can see that the PSF is centered on the (n/2, n/2) pixel. So the center is now (16, 16). This is a property of the FFT and the orientation convention OpticStudio uses. While the grid center is at n/2 + 1 in one domain (spatial) it is at n/2 in ...

WebWe can use interferometric methods, however these may be limited to the use of coherent light (like a laser). Shack-Hartmann wavefront sensors can work in incoherent and even broad-band light. A Shack-Hartmann wavefront sensor consists of an array of micro-lenses focusing portions of an incoming wavefront onto position-sensitive detectors.
